What a Way to Start the Week

Man, if Rick Warren came to DC and gave us a pep talk every Monday ministry would be so much easier! That was one of the most meaningful conversations about ministry I've ever been part of it. So much great stuff.
One of the big take aways for me was this: we grow by making commitments. Rick said you don't grow to commitment. You grow through commitment. Every weekend at Saddleback they ask for some kind of commitment. Everybody is asking us for commitments. If the church doesn't ask, people will commit to other things! One of the most important tools for spiritual growth at Saddleback is a simple commitment card.
I think we experienced that this weekend with our message on fasting. We asked people to commit to two things: 1) a 40 day fast 2) a twenty-four hour food fast and give $24 toward the Convoy of Hope we will be hosting this year in DC.
It is so easy to walk out of church and do nothing with what we've heard. We audit the Bible. But spiritual maturity is not head knowledge. If it was the Pharisees would have been the most spiritually mature people in Jesus' day. It's about transformation not information.
